An Evening with Craig Johnson | Main Point Books
Jun 9, 2024 (UTC-5)ENDED
Wayne
Craig Johnson makes a highly anticipated return to Main Point Books in Wayne for the upcoming Longmire novel, "First Frost." Taking place on June 9th, 2024, this ticketed event requires the purchase of the book. Attendees can choose between two ticket options: a single ticket for $32, including a signed copy of "First Frost," or a double ticket for $42, which includes the novel and a $10 coupon towards another book purchase. The event will be held in the lower level event space, featuring a talk followed by a book signing and reception with complimentary snacks and drinks. In this twentieth installment of the Longmire series, readers will once again follow Sheriff Walt Longmire as he navigates the complexities of his personal life amidst the changing and dangerous landscape of Wyoming. Facing a malevolent scheme that threatens those closest to him, Walt must confront a new reality that could forever alter his perception of the cherished Wyoming countryside.

Cakewalk: A Fully Baked Memoir | Main Point Books
Oct 10, 2024 (UTC-5)ENDED
Wayne
After 9/11, three sisters decided to go into business together making liqueur-infused cake. In this hilarious memoir, they tell the story of how they managed to sneak their creation to Food Network and Rachel Ray. This event with sisters Carole Algier, Sue Katein, and Kathy Lanyon will be in our lower level event space. Reservations are requested via Eventbrite. Signed books can be ordered through the store's website and will be available at the event. About the Book Born to a depressed, exhausted mother and an abusive father who uses his seven children as cheap labor for his business schemes, Sue, Carole, and Kathy raise themselves in their chaotic household. The sisters all marry young; two divorce quickly. But despite the obstacles they face, the three women grow into confident businesswomen and remain extremely close as they build families and recover from their toxic childhood. After the 9/11 terrorist attacks, the sisters gather over chilled martinis to take a serious look at the future and decide they should be together—in business. Bring on the cake. Liqueur-infused cake, that is. They soon start handing out samples of their inventions at farmers markets like seasoned carnival barkers, and soon a Food Network producer who’s stopped by their table invites them to New York City—sparking a hilarious adventure involving one-way streets, security guards, and the NYPD, all in an effort to get their cake into the hands of the producers at The Food Network and Rachel Ray.

Kay Chronister "The Bog Wife" | Main Point Books
Oct 16, 2024 (UTC-5)ENDED
Wayne
Main Point Books welcomes Kay Chronister and new novel The Bog Wife, a “haunting, brilliant” Appalachian folktale. She'll be joined by guest host A.C. Wise. This event is in our lower level event space. Registration is requested via Eventbrite; walk-ins are welcome. Books can be ordered for pick-up at the store or to be mailed within the US. About the Book Since time immemorial, the Haddesley family has tended the cranberry bog. In exchange, the bog sustains them. The staunch seasons of their lives are governed by a strict covenant that is renewed each generation with the ritual sacrifice of their patriarch, and in return, the bog produces a “bog-wife.” Brought to life from vegetation, this woman is meant to carry on the family line. But when the bog fails—or refuses—to honor the bargain, the Haddesleys, a group of discordant siblings still grieving the mother who mysteriously disappeared years earlier, face an unknown future.

An Evening with Alexander McCall Smith | Main Point Books
Oct 21, 2024 (UTC-5)ENDED
Wayne
Main Point Books is THRILLED to welcome Alexander McCall Smith on a rare US visit to celebrate the release of the 25th No. 1 Ladies' Detective Series title, The Great Hippopotamus Hotel. He'll be joined by special guest Alan Drew. This is a ticketed event. There are two ticket options: 1 seat/ 1 book for $30, and 2 seats/ 1 Book & coupon for $45. The No. 1 Ladies' Detective Agency has been readers' favorite since the first title was published in 1998. Main character Mma Precious Ramotswe helps her friends, neighbors, and community solve mysteries and resolve life issues. The stories are set in the cities of Botswana, on the edge of the Kalahari desert. Mystery fans have raced through each new title!
